Abstract

The utility model discloses a multi-space building block containing box which comprises a box body and a box cover, wherein the box body is open at the upper part and is in a trapezoidal open shape, a plurality of vertical partition plates which can be flexibly disassembled and combined with each other are arranged in the box body, the partition plates are combined at different positions to divide a cavity in the box body into a plurality of containing cavities with different vertical sizes, the shape and the volume of each containing cavity are formed by combining the vertical partition plates and the inner side wall of the box body together, and each two adjacent containing cavities are mutually independent or communicated by different combinations of the partition plates. According to the utility model, through improving the integral structural design, a plurality of detachable vertical partition plates capable of flexibly moving connecting positions are arranged in the box body, and the cavity in the box body is divided into a plurality of containing cavities with different sizes and shapes by matching with the inner side wall of the box body, so that semi-finished building block models and finished building block models with different sizes and heights can be placed in a classified manner, and the structure is simple, the containing effect is good, and the containing volume is large.

Example 1
Referring to fig. 1 to 11, the multi-space building block storage box provided by the present invention may be specifically used for storing building block components, semi-finished building block models, and finished building block models in a home, a kindergarten, or a place of business (a mall), and includes a box body 1 and a box cover 2, wherein the box cover 2 is disposed on the upper portion of the box body 1, and is characterized in that: the box body 1 is an upper opening, the outline is trapezoidal open shape, a plurality of partition boards 3 which can be flexibly disassembled and combined with each other are arranged in the box body 1, the partition boards 3 are combined through different positions to separate the cavity in the box body 1 into a plurality of storage cavities 4 different in vertical size, the shape and the volume of each storage cavity 4 are formed by combining the partition boards 3 and the inner side wall of the box body 1 together, every two adjacent storage cavities 4 are mutually independent or communicated through different combinations of the partition boards 3, through improving the structural design of the multi-space building block storage box, the structure, the components and the combination mode of the storage box are simplified, the traditional shape, the structure and the use habit of the storage box are adopted as a shell, the plurality of partition boards which can be disassembled and flexibly move connecting positions are arranged in the box body, the inner side wall of the box body is matched, and the cavity in the box body is separated into a plurality of sizes (heights), The cavity of accomodating that the shape differs to the classification of realization to semi-manufactured goods building blocks model and finished product building blocks model of different volumes, height is placed, is complicated in order to solve current containing box structure, accomodates that the volume is little, be not conform to user's use custom scheduling problem, makes the structure that it can satisfy simultaneously succinct, accomodate the volume big, accomodate effectual demand.
Specifically, the partition board 3 is a longitudinal partition board 31 and at least one transverse partition board 32, the transverse partition board 32 is detachably connected to the longitudinal partition board 31, a plurality of groups of vertical insertion grooves 6 are oppositely arranged on the inner surface of the side wall of the box body 1, the longitudinal partition board 31 is inserted into the insertion grooves 6, one end of the transverse partition board 32 is connected to the longitudinal partition board 31, the other end of the transverse partition board 32 is inserted into the insertion grooves 6, and the left and right storage cavities inside the box body 1 partitioned by the longitudinal partition board 31 are further partitioned into a front storage cavity and a rear storage cavity which are smaller.
In the embodiment, the multi-space building block containing box adopts the box body with an opening at the upper part and a trapezoidal outline as the shell, so that the habit that a user frequently uses the box body is met, and the larger volume of the containing space of the box body can be ensured; simultaneously with a plurality of baffles settings that can dismantle, can move the hookup location in a flexible way inside the box, cooperation box inside wall separates the inside cavity of box for a plurality of sizes (height), the cavity of accomodating that the shape differs, the structure is succinct, the installation of being convenient for. The building block type building block storage box is characterized in that the partition plates are longitudinal partition plates or a combination of the longitudinal partition plates and transverse partition plates, a plurality of groups of vertical insertion grooves are oppositely arranged on the inner surface of the side wall of the box body, the longitudinal partition plates are inserted between the two insertion grooves, and the transverse partition plates are inserted between the longitudinal partition plates and the insertion grooves; the novel storage box has the advantages of simple structure, large storage volume, good storage effect and accordance with the use habits of users.
Specifically, an independent accommodating support plate 5 is further arranged in the accommodating cavity 4, at least one open accommodating groove 51 with an upward opening is formed in the accommodating support plate 5, and the outline of the outer edge of the accommodating support plate 5 is matched with the inner side wall of the box body 1.
In this embodiment, through be provided with one in accomodating the cavity and accomodate the layer board to be provided with a plurality of uncovered shapes on accomodating the layer board and accomodate the groove, can realize accomodating the classification of different types of building blocks parts and size, and can also place building blocks parts and semi-manufactured goods building blocks model or finished product building blocks model classification, avoid accomodating the confusion that causes the part because of obscuring.
Specifically, at least one slot 311 is formed in the longitudinal partition plate 31 along the width direction thereof, a protruding portion 321 with an L-shaped cross section is disposed on one side of the transverse partition plate 32 adjacent to the longitudinal partition plate 31, and the protruding portion 321 is inserted into the slot 311 to vertically fix the transverse partition plate 32 on the longitudinal partition plate 31.
In this embodiment, the insertion slots 311 are two strip-shaped insertion slots 311, the two strip-shaped insertion slots 311 are perpendicular to the longitudinal partition plate 31, a protruding portion 321 with an L-shaped cross section is disposed on one side of the transverse partition plate 32 adjacent to the longitudinal partition plate 31, and the protruding portion 321 is inserted into the insertion slot 311, so that the longitudinal partition plate 31 and the transverse partition plate 32 are detachably connected.
Specifically, the upper portion of the slot 311 is further provided with a fastening hole 312, the fastening hole 312 is opened on the longitudinal partition plate 31, a fastening block 322 is further disposed between the transverse partition plate 32 and the protruding portion 321, and the fastening block 322 is fastened in the fastening hole 312.
In this embodiment, the fastening holes 312 are two rectangular fastening holes 312, the two rectangular fastening holes 312 are respectively and oppositely disposed on the upper portion of the slot 311, a fastening block 322 is further disposed between the transverse partition plate 32 and the protruding portion 321, the fastening block 322 is composed of two oppositely disposed circular arc protrusions, a certain gap is further disposed between the two circular arc protrusions, and the fastening block 322 is fastened in the fastening holes 312 to enhance the connection stability between the longitudinal partition plate 31 and the transverse partition plate 32, and prevent the longitudinal partition plate 31 and the transverse partition plate 32 from moving up and down.
Specifically, one side of the longitudinal partition plate 31 is provided with at least one clamping groove 313 along the width direction thereof, the clamping groove 313 and the insertion groove 6 are located on the same vertical line, one side of the transverse partition plate 32 adjacent to the longitudinal partition plate 31 is provided with a clamping claw 323, and the clamping claw 323 is inserted into the clamping groove 313.
In this embodiment, the locking groove 313 is formed by two opposite projections having a cross-section, the two locking grooves 313 are respectively and oppositely disposed on the upper portion of the slot 311, the clamping claw 323 is disposed on one side of the transverse partition plate 32 adjacent to the longitudinal partition plate 31, and the clamping claw 323 is inserted into the locking groove 313 to enhance the connection stability between the longitudinal partition plate 31 and the transverse partition plate 32 and prevent the longitudinal partition plate 31 and the transverse partition plate 32 from moving left and right.
Specifically, the inner surface of the bottom of the box body is further provided with at least one limiting fixture block 7, the limiting fixture block 7 is arranged between two oppositely arranged insertion grooves 6, and the longitudinal partition plate 31 is inserted into the insertion grooves 6 and the limiting fixture block 7.
In this embodiment, the limiting fixture block 7 is formed by four opposite projections having a cross section in a shape of "l", the two slots 313 are respectively and oppositely disposed between the insertion grooves 6, and the longitudinal partition plate 31 and the transverse partition plate 32 are both inserted into the insertion grooves 6 and the limiting fixture block 7, thereby effectively improving the connection stability between the longitudinal partition plate 31 and the transverse partition plate 32.
Specifically, in the box body 1, between the box cover 2 and each partition plate 3, a horizontal supporting plate 8 is further arranged, a plurality of grooves 82 different in size are formed in the horizontal supporting plate 8, the outer edge of the horizontal supporting plate 8 is overlapped with the edge of the upper opening of the box body 1, the upper opening of the box body 1 is sealed, the inner space of the box body 1 is divided into an upper accommodating space and a lower accommodating space, at least one protrusion 81 is arranged on two sides of the horizontal supporting plate 8 along the length direction of the horizontal supporting plate, a limiting groove 9 is formed in one side, opposite to the protrusion 81, of the box body 1, and the protrusion 81 and the limiting groove 9 are mutually embedded.
In this embodiment, at least one protrusion 81 is disposed on two sides of the horizontal supporting plate 8 along the length direction thereof, a limiting groove 9 is disposed on one side of the box body 1 opposite to the protrusion 81, and the protrusion 81 and the limiting groove 9 are mutually embedded. Still be provided with a plurality of recesses 82 that differ in size on the horizontal pallet 8, multiple building blocks parts also can be placed to recess 82 inside, set up a horizontal pallet that is used for preventing the inside building blocks of box to pop out through the opening part at the box, horizontal pallet detachably connects in the opening part of box, horizontal pallet can seal the inside cavity of box, not only can guarantee the stability that the inside building blocks of box were placed, but also can avoid the inside building blocks of box to jump out to the box outside, guarantee the sealing performance of box.
Example 2
Referring to fig. 12, the multi-space building block storage box provided in this embodiment is substantially the same as embodiment 1, except that: the partition board 3 comprises a longitudinal partition board 31, a set of vertical insertion grooves 6 are oppositely arranged on two sides of the box body 1 along the length direction of the box body, the longitudinal partition board 31 is inserted into the insertion grooves 6 and is connected and combined with the box body 1, the space inside the box body 1 is divided into a left storage cavity and a right storage cavity, the storage diversity of the storage box can be improved, and the storage box can be used for placing a large-size log model.
